Output 834d2ecb886470965b0e99055629b1703fb775ae40f5dc5a5684c4790f5ea94e:0

value
21831612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61f6582bfad780e80944499c588c9308f33311f0 OP_EQUAL
address
3AczaTjafASLcmf5DYuUi29vQhdr9ydpqz
transaction
834d2ecb886470965b0e99055629b1703fb775ae40f5dc5a5684c4790f5ea94e
spent
true